The best internet providers in Madison are AT&T Fiber and Spectrum. AT&T Fiber offers a fiber-optic connection with symmetrical download and upload speeds up to 5 Gbps. AT&T ranked second in customer satisfaction in the North Central area in the latest J.D. Power survey.
The second-best internet option in Madison is Spectrum. Its cable connection uses existing cable TV infrastructure, making it a widely available and convenient option. Spectrum can keep up with fiber internet competitors by offering download speeds up to 1 Gbps (wireless speeds may vary).
In Madison, the fastest internet providers are AT&T Fiber, Spectrum, and TDS. AT&T Fiber is the fastest internet provider, with speeds soaring up to 5 Gbps. These fiber speeds can sustain multiple streaming devices, video meetings, and security cameras simultaneously — an ideal option for households with multiple work-from-home residents or high-data internet users.
The second-fastest internet provider in Madison is Spectrum, which offers speeds up to 1 Gbps (wireless speeds may vary). Symmetrical download and upload speeds aren’t possible on a cable connection, but Spectrum can still handle multiple internet activities at once.
Another fast internet provider in the area is TDS. Operating on a fiber connection, TDS offers Madison residents gigabit speeds at low prices.
The most accessible internet provider in Madison is Spectrum, which covers 86.4 percent of the city. Whether you’re in Mifflin West or Marquette, Spectrum has your internet covered. AT&T Fiber is available in 46.2 percent of Madison, with outage zones in the southwest part of the city, specifically around Lake Wingra. AT&T’s internet protocol broadband (IPBB) connection makes up for these areas, offering coverage to 68.9 percent of Madison residents.
